Using the Recycle Bin
For most applications, when a record in the app is deleted in Kahua, the record appears in the Recycle Bin application. A domain administrator can restore those records from the Recycle Bin or permanently delete them prior to their permanent deletion date.
Important After a record has been permanently deleted from the Recycle Bin, Kahua cannot retrieve the content.
Important things to know about the Recycle Bin app include the following:
-
The Recycle Bin is a domain level application. You do not need to be in a specific project to recover records from that project. Only users with appropriate permissions to the Recycle Bin can restore items or permanently delete them from Kahua manually.
-
Additional users can be granted permissions to the Recycle Bin app through the Groups app. You must be in the root domain to assign permissions to the Recycle Bin app. Refer to Setting up groups.
-
When a record is deleted from an app and appears in the Recycle Bin, it is assigned a Recycle Delete Date. On the Recycle Delete Date, the record is automatically and permanently deleted.
-
The retention period which determines the calculated Recycle Delete Date is configured in the Domain Settings > Domain Defaults > Recycle Bin Retention Settings section. Refer to Recycle Bin Retention Settings.
-
You can select Restore on a record to prevent its deletion and restore it to the original app.
-
You can select Permanent Delete on a record to permanently delete it prior to its assigned Recycle Delete Date.
How to . . .
To restore a record from the Recycle Bin back to its original application, prior to its permanent deletion on the Recycle Delete Date, complete the following steps:
-
Navigate to the Recycle Bin application (All Apps > Administration > Recycle Bin). As this is a domain level application, you do not need to be in a specific project to recover records from that project.
-
You can use Manage Views to group/filter for projects. You can also use Search to narrow results in the log.
-
Select the appropriate record in the log. The view of the record will be available in the detail pane.
-
Click Restore at the top of the record. A confirmation message will appear.
-
Click OK on the confirmation message to restore the record to its original location in its original project or partition. Click Cancel to cancel the restoration.
To permanently delete a record from the Recycle Bin, complete the following steps:
-
Navigate to the Recycle Bin application (All Apps > Administration > Recycle Bin). As this is a domain level application, you do not need to be in a specific project to delete records from that project.
-
You can use Manage Views to group/filter for projects. You can also use Search to narrow results in the log. Refer to Log Views and Log Reporting.
-
Select the appropriate record in the log. The view of the record will be available in the detail pane.
-
Click Permanent Delete at the top of the record. A confirmation message will appear.
-
Click OK on the confirmation message to permanently delete the record. Click Cancel to continue to retain the record.
Important Once a record has been permanently deleted, it cannot be recovered.
